GUEST SERVICE RETAIL SALES LEAD
The Country Life Shop – Kitchen Kettle Village
Intercourse, Pa | $16 per hour | Full-time

Perks & Benefits
- Family-owned and operated since 1954
- Non-traditional retail and food service hours - Closed evenings and Sundays
- Medical, Dental, Vision
- Penn Medicine HealthWorks
- 401(k)
- Paid Time Off
- Wellness programs
- Scheduling flexibility for work/life balance
- 20% discount at all Kitchen Kettle Foods and Burnley Enterprise shops
- Learning and development opportunities
What You’ll Do
- Work with the store manager to grow the sales culture of the Country Life to maximize results, while maintaining and setting the example for outstanding guest service
- Be on the floor at all times unless assisting a guest with products or directed otherwise by the manager
- Greet guests, engage them in conversation and listen for opportunities to answer their questions and offer product suggestions
- Assist in Monitoring team member engagement with guests and assist the manager in training and ensuring our retail team delivers World Class Service to all guests
- Be an expert in product and furniture knowledge and be extremely comfortable with making product recommendations
- Be aware of the lines at the register and be prepared to help at registers when necessary
- Ensure product displays are attractive and maintained efficiently as directed by the manager and merchandising team
- Help oversee the cleanliness of the shop by ensuring team members are following cleaning lists and rotating displays as well as completing cleaning/organizing projects during slow periods
- Assist with all retail store physical inventory counting, adjusting, and discrepancy correction
- Be able to open and/or close the retail store as needed, and complete the daily deposit paperwork
- Be proficient in Fusion and AccuPos (POS System) and be capable of covering every position in the shop
- Be proficient with Microsoft products (Word, Excel, Outlook)
